Constructing a foundation pad in Huntington Beach, CA, involves various considerations that can influence the overall cost. From material choices to labor fees, understanding these factors can help homeowners and businesses budget effectively for their construction projects.
Factors Affecting Cost
- Material Quality: Higher-grade materials often come at a premium price but offer better durability.
- Labor Rates: Labor costs in Huntington Beach can be higher due to the area's cost of living.
- Site Preparation: Costs can increase if extensive site clearing or grading is required.
- Permit Fees: Local regulations may require permits, adding to the overall expense.
- Pad Size: Larger pads will naturally cost more due to increased material and labor needs.
- Complexity of Design: Custom or intricate designs can raise costs due to additional labor and materials.
- Soil Conditions: Poor soil may require additional work like soil stabilization, which can increase costs.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task | Average Cost (USD) |
---|---|
Site Preparation | $1,500 - $3,000 |
Concrete Materials | $2,000 - $5,000 |
Labor (per hour) | $50 - $100 |
Permit Fees | $500 - $1,000 |
Soil Testing and Stabilization | $1,000 - $2,500 |
Foundation Pad Installation | $5,000 - $10,000 |
Finishing and Cleanup | $500 - $1,500 |
